Valpolicella Doc Classico – Vini Venturini
Vinification: It is crafted from 70% Corvina, 25% Rondinella, and 5% Molinara grapes. The winemaking process involves gentle rolling pressing and destemming, followed by around eight days of maceration with daily pumpovers. After the primary fermentation, the wine undergoes malolactic fermentation in the months following racking, resulting in a balanced and expressive wine that captures the spirit of its region.
Tasting Note: It boasts a vibrant ruby red colour and an inviting aroma of black cherry and redcurrant, enhanced by a refreshing balsamic note.
